Michigan Congresswoman introduces articles of impeachment against RFK Jr.

A Congresswoman from the Great Lakes State has formally introduced articles of impeachment against the Secretary of Health and Human Services.

Michigan Congresswoman Haley Stevens introduced articles of impeachment against Robert F. Kennedy Jr. on Wednesday.

According to her office, she is citing that his actions have allegedly “endangered public health” and “gutted lifesaving medical research.”

In the text, the Congresswoman alleges that RFK Jr. has restricted access to vaccines, failed to carry out statutory duties, and made cuts to research focused on children, among other things.

The Representative issued this statement on the matter:

Secretary Robert F. Kennedy Jr. has turned his back on science, on public health, and on the American people – spreading conspiracies and lies, driving up costs, and putting lives at risk. Under his watch, families are less safe and less healthy, people are paying more for care, lifesaving research has been gutted, and vaccines have been restricted. He has driven up health care costs while tearing down the scientific institutions that keep Michiganders and families across America safe. His actions are reckless, his leadership is harmful, and his tenure has become a direct threat to our nation’s health and security. Congress cannot and will not stand by while one man dismantles decades of medical progress.
